Standard C Library Functions floating_to_decimal(3C)
NAME
floating_to_decimal, single_to_decimal, double_to_decimal,
extended_to_decimal, quadruple_to_decimal - convert
floating-point value to decimal record
SYNOPSIS
#include
void single_to_decimal(single *px, decimal_mode *pm,
decimal_record *pd, fp_exception_field_type *ps);
void double_to_decimal(double *px, decimal_mode *pm,
decimal_record *pd, fp_exception_field_type *ps);
void extended_to_decimal(extended *px, decimal_mode *pm,
decimal_record *pd, fp_exception_field_type *ps);
void quadruple_to_decimal(quadruple *px, decimal_mode *pm,
decimal_record *pd, fp_exception_field_type *ps);
DESCRIPTION
The floating_to_decimal functions convert the floating-point
value at *px into a decimal record at *pd, observing the modes specified in *pm and setting exceptions in *ps. If there are no IEEE exceptions, *ps will be zero.If *px is zero, infinity, or NaN, then only pd->sign and
pd->fpclass are set. Otherwise pd->exponent and pd->ds are
also set so that(sig)*(pd->ds)*10**(pd->exponent)
is a correctly rounded approximation to *px, where sig is +1or -1, depending upon whether pd->sign is 0 or -1. pd->ds
has at least one and no more than DECIMAL_STRING_LENGTH-1
significant digits because one character is used to ter-
minate the string with a null.pd->ds is correctly rounded according to the IEEE rounding
modes in pm->rd. *ps has fp_inexact set if the result was
inexact, and has fp_overflow set if the string result does
not fit in pd->ds because of the limitation
DECIMAL_STRING_LENGTH.

If pm->df == floating_form, then pd->ds always contains
pm->ndigits significant digits. Thus if *px == 12.34 and
pm->ndigits == 8, then pd->ds will contain 12340000 and
pd->exponent will contain -6.
If pm->df == fixed_form and pm->ndigits >= 0, then the
decimal value is rounded at pm->ndigits digits to the right
of the decimal point. For example, if *px == 12.34 andpm->ndigits == 1, then pd->ds will contain 123 and
pd->exponent will be set to -1.
If pm->df == fixed_form and pm->ndigits< 0, then the decimal
value is rounded at -pm->ndigits digits to the left of the
decimal point, and pd->ds is padded with trailing zeros up
to the decimal point. For example, if *px == 12.34 and pm->n
digits == -1, then pd->ds will contain 10 and pd->exponent
will be set to 0.When pm->df == fixed_form and the value to be converted is
large enough that the resulting string would contain morethan DECIMAL_STRING_LENGTH-1 digits, then the string placed
in pd->ds is limited to exactly DECIMAL_STRING_LENGTH-1
digits (by moving the place at which the value is roundedfurther left if need be), pd->exponent is adjusted accord-
ingly and the overflow flag is set in *ps.pd->more is not used.
The econvert(3C), fconvert(3C), gconvert(3C), printf(3C),and sprintf(3C) functions all use double_to_decimal().
